The Challenge

As The Stevens Group continued to grow, so did the complexity of managing documents across multiple companies, departments, and ERP systems. The organization needed a central document management platform that could support: 

 

• Multiple business units 

• Role-based access and separation of duties 

• High-volume accounts payable processing 

• Accounts receivable documentation 

• ERP integrations across different operating companies 

• Consistent document storage, routing, approval, and retrieval 

 

Accounts payable was a key area for improvement. Invoices needed to be captured, indexed, routed for approval, and entered into the appropriate ERP system. Manual indexing and processing created extra work for accounting staff and slowed down the overall process.

The solution

The Stevens Group uses OnBase as its central electronic document repository, with Savvy Source providing technical support, implementation, and integration services. The OnBase environment supports a wide range of document and workflow processes, including accounts payable automation, accounts receivable document capture, billing documentation, corporate records, legal agreements, finance documents, and contracts. Most recently, Savvy Source helped The Stevens Group reduce manual effort with Savvy OCR, a capture tool that helps index accounts payable invoices automatically. With Savvy OCR, AP invoices are captured, categorized, and routed to the correct approvers based on defined business rules. Once approved, invoices are automatically uploaded into the appropriate ERP system, including Jonas. This gives the accounting team a single view of AP invoices across multiple business units while still maintaining the controls, routing, and separation required by each company.

Integrated Systems

Savvy Source has helped Stevens connect OnBase with several systems used across the organization, including: 

○ Outlook 

○ iPad mobile approval 

○ Jonas Construction ERP 

○ CommandSeries Saradex ERP

The results

By extending OnBase with Savvy OCR and continuing to improve document workflows, The Stevens Group has created a stronger, more scalable document management foundation. Current results include: 

 

 

• 560 GB of managed documents 

• 5 million files stored in OnBase 

• 47% annual labor savings using OCR capture technology 

• 4 integrated systems 

• 30 OnBase workflows 

• One central repository for enterprise documents 

• Reduced reliance on physical file cabinets 

• Improved visibility across accounting processes 

• Better separation of duties by business unit 

• More consistent AP invoice routing and approval 

• Consolidated accounting work by function

The Stevens Group of Companies is a Fourth Generation family owned group of companies headquartered in Dartmouth, Nova Scotia. What began as a small construction company has grown into a large diverse group serving Tilt Up Construction, Ready Mix Concrete, Aggregate Quarries, Precast Concrete, Commercial Doors Frames and Hardware, Commercial Millwork, Commercial Properties, Long Term care and other related industries.

Across its many companies, The Stevens Group manages a large volume of business-critical documents, including accounts payable invoices, delivery tickets, customer invoices, legal agreements, finance records, contracts, and corporate documentation.

For more than eight years, Savvy Source has supported The Stevens Group, beginning with the company’s initial OnBase deployment and continuing through upgrades, server migrations, workflow expansion, ERP integrations, and the rollout of OnBase across multiple business units.
